What is the church for? Who are God’s people? What does abundant life look like? Church leaders and people of faith continue to do more than preserve what they have, they want what Jesus came to bring: abundant life. This book aims to anchor a theology and model of social engagement in the most important word in the Bible: with. Samuel Wells, vicar of St. Martin-in-the-Fields in London, has written nearly fifty books on how the Jesus came to be with people, not to fix their problems but to live into God’s abundance. This book builds on Wells’s theology to show how one church lived into that theology and that model with abundant results. Abundance isn’t a mindset; it’s a model of how people live with their neighbors and of discovering where their true treasure lies, in relationships.
